12 Information Technology Stocks Moving In Tuesday's After-Market Session
Share
Listen to the news

Gainers

  • Sphere 3D (NASDAQ:ANY) stock rose 10.6% to $2.71 during Tuesday's after-market session. The market value of their outstanding shares is at $20.1 million.
  • Arbe Robotics (NASDAQ:ARBE) stock increased by 8.62% to $0.81. The company's market cap stands at $80.9 million.
  • TROOPS (NASDAQ:TROO) stock rose 6.85% to $2.24. The company's market cap stands at $273.6 million.
  • Mobix Labs (NASDAQ:MOBX) stock rose 6.29% to $1.35. The market value of their outstanding shares is at $16.6 million.
  • MaxLinear (NASDAQ:MXL) stock moved upwards by 3.9% to $69.1. The market value of their outstanding shares is at $5.6 billion.
  • MACOM Technology Solns (NASDAQ:MTSI) stock increased by 3.3% to $283.87. The market value of their outstanding shares is at $20.5 billion.

Losers

  • ServiceTitan (NASDAQ:TTAN) shares declined by 19.8% to $65.45 during Tuesday's after-market session. The company's market cap stands at $8.3 billion. The company's, Q2 earnings came out today.
  • Lianhe Sowell Intl (NASDAQ:LHSW) stock fell 11.37% to $1.17. The company's market cap stands at $60.7 million.
  • Braze (NASDAQ:BRZE) stock declined by 9.89% to $27.31. The company's market cap stands at $3.5 billion. As per the news, the Q2 earnings report came out today.
  • Rail Vision (NASDAQ:RVSN) stock declined by 7.28% to $4.08. The market value of their outstanding shares is at $8.9 million.
  • Sangrix (NASDAQ:SGRX) shares decreased by 5.49% to $1.55. The company's market cap stands at $3.3 million.
